Fitting
Each cartridge loop pattern is specifically designed to the cartridge for secure retention. The loops should hold the cartridges half way down the case as pictured in the product photos. Take your time with the initial fit of your cartridges because it will be snug! Once successfully fitted, it will get easier to use as your belt slide breaks in.
DO NOT force the cartridge rim through the loops or try to fit different calibre cartridges into the loops . If you stretch the loops with cartridges that are too big for the design, they will never be the same.
Use & Care
Preserving snug retention is as easy as removing the cartridges from the loops when not in use. Leather goods will last if they are properly used and cared for, which is the buyers responsibility.
Quality and durable construction is our job and we have carefully selected low maintenance leathers for our belt slide range. The front panel of the belt slide does not need to be conditioned and we highly discourage conditioning the crazy horse cartridge loops. The back of the belt slide is a firm vegetable tanned leather that can be conditioned as required if it begins looking dry.
It’s not recommended to hunt in the rain or get your leather gear wet. If your gear does get wet, remove the cartridges and allow them to dry at room temperature out of the sun.
Please Note - This belt slide is not a long term storage solution for Ammunition. We recommend removing the shells when not in use to maintain snug retention.
